For commercial frozen storage in Ireland, operators typically target around -18°C product temperature for safe long-term storage. On Irish listings, Unifrost upright freezers are commonly shown operating roughly in the -17°C to -25°C range with electronic control.
Practical setpoint guidance:
Set a working setpoint that reliably keeps product at or below -18°C during your busiest periods.
Use a separate calibrated probe/thermometer (in a product pack or glycol bottle) to cross-check the controller reading, especially during commissioning or after a power cut.
If you are logging for HACCP, record actual cabinet or product temperature (not just the setpoint) and note any corrective action if readings drift.
